Output 62ceeefba0525635c9954489d90a77332cab63c2a098cad8924d5e4a8080dd6e:0

value
1096089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5621a86b5b7bcf93792261700fb806aefd6df0 OP_EQUAL
address
38qDp2V5HMgaNMnd4N4DxNMM8cbhZqHQYV
transaction
62ceeefba0525635c9954489d90a77332cab63c2a098cad8924d5e4a8080dd6e
spent
true